Sweet corn processing and vacuum packaging
Sweet corn introduction
Sweet corn is a naturally occurring genetic variant of field corn, and its kernels store more sugar than field corn. Fresh sweet corn has a genetic trait that inhibits the conversion of sugar into starch. Compared with ordinary corn, sweet corn has significant differences in the content of starch, sugar, protein, fat and vitamins. The protein content of fresh sweet corn kernels is above 13%, the sugar content is above 10%, and the crude fat content is around 9.9%. Every 100g of sweet corn contains 0.7mg vitamin C, 0.22mg niacin and vitamin B2, and 1.70mg riboflavin and vitamin B2. .In addition, sweet corn also contains a variety of volatile aromatic substances, minerals, dietary fiber, oryzanol, sterols and other ingredients.
Sweet corn cob processing and Vacuum Packaging process
The processing process of sweet corn can be summarized as follows: raw material harvesting → pretreatment → (removing husks and cobs → grading and sorting → cleaning → punching) → precooking → cooling → vacuum packaging → sterilization → shaping → cooling → insulation inspection → finished product
Raw material harvesting
Sweet corn in the milky stage (18-20 days after pollination) should be selected and harvested on a sunny morning, leaving (2~4) husks. After fresh sweet corn cobs are picked according to the harvesting standards, they must not be thrown on the ground at will, and they must not be violently collided or squeezed during loading and unloading and transportation. They must be handled carefully to reduce losses and increase yields. Corn cobs must be free of insects, with grains arranged neatly and plumply. Corn cobs with insects can still be used as raw materials after being trimmed to meet the requirements.

Pretreatment of sweet corn after harvest
Harvested sweet corn cobs should be protected from the sun and rain, and sent to the processing plant in time (within 12h) at low temperature.

Trim the corn cobs to a uniform length, manually or using an automatic corn cob trimmer.
Wash the corn cobs with clean water, manually or using a bubble washer.
Pre-cooking and blanching of sweet corn
Add 0.1% citric acid and 1% salt to the blanching water, the temperature is 95℃-100℃, the time is 5-12 minutes, so that the corn cob temperature reaches above 95℃. Steam blanching can also be used.
The main purpose of pre-cooking and blanching is:
Soften the tissue, remove the air in the tender corn tissue, reduce the pressure of ice crystal formation during freezing, and correspondingly reduce the oxidation degree of the raw materials, which helps to maintain the color and nutrition of the product.
Blanching destroys enzyme activity, stabilizes color, improves flavor and tissue, and prevents the destruction of nutrients in corn.
Blanching can remove some of the moisture in sweet corn and keep the solidified material stable.
Blanching can kill some microorganisms in the corn cob, reduce the number of pathogens, and lay the foundation for improving the sterilization effect.

Cooling and drying of sweet corn
The corn cobs must be cooled in time after blanching, otherwise the corn kernels will wrinkle due to high temperature water loss, affecting the appearance and quality of the corn. Generally, spray with clean water or soak in cold water for 3-5 minutes to reduce the surface temperature of the corn to ensure that the temperature of the corn cobs is around 50℃ during the next step of packaging. If the temperature of the corn cobs is too high, the water will evaporate and produce steam during the vacuum packaging process, which will have an adverse effect on the quality of the vacuum packaging.
Before entering the vacuum packaging step, the corn cobs should be blown dry on an automatic dryer to eliminate moisture.
Vacuum packaging of sweet corn cobs
According to the different packaging materials, the vacuum packaging machines for sweet corn cobs can be roughly divided into two categories:
Vacuum packaging machines using pre-made vacuum bags
Vacuum packaging machines using roll film automatic bag making.

Vacuum packaging machines using pre-made bags mainly include single double chamber vacuum packaging machines and continues vacuum packaging machines。

The vacuum packaging machine that uses roll film automatically is also called the commonly used fully automatic stretch film vacuum packaging machine, or thermoforming vacuum packaging machine.

High temperature sterilization
Before high temperature sterilization, check whether the quality of vacuum packaging meets the standard requirements. Qualified packaged products are sent to the sterilizer for high temperature sterilization. The sterilization method is 15'-20'-20'/121℃, that is, the temperature in the sterilization tank reaches 121℃ in 15 minutes and the temperature is kept constant for 20 minutes. During this period, the pressure in the sterilization tank must be kept stable, otherwise the bag will break. Because the moisture in the packaging bag will expand when heated. To prevent the bag from breaking, back pressure cooling should be used, and the pressure should be 0.02-0.03 MPa higher than the sterilization pressure. The cooling time is 20 minutes, and the temperature drops to 40°C.

Cleaning, drying and storage of packaging
Use an automatic cleaning and drying line to clean and dry the packaging, and check the quality of the vacuum packaging to see if there is any leakage or bag breakage.
Store the vacuum-packed sweet corn cobs at room temperature, and the shelf life can reach 6-12 months.
Conclusion
There are several key points to pay attention to in the processing and vacuum packaging of pre-cooked sweet corn cobs, including:
The quality of sweet corn raw materials. The basic factors that determine the edible and processing quality of sweet corn are the sugar content and water-soluble polysaccharide content of the corn kernels. Polysaccharides are a multi-branched small molecule starch that is soluble in water and has a waxy taste. It is one of the main factors that make up the flavor of sweet corn. The tenderness of the peel is also one of the factors that affect the taste. Therefore, when the corn is harvested, it is necessary to determine that the above three factors of sweet corn are in the best state based on observation and research.
Precooking and blanching time. On the one hand, blanching can inactivate various enzymes in the sweet corn cobs, so that the nutrients in the corn are not destroyed, and can effectively prevent discoloration (corn kernels may turn purple if not properly cooked) and extend the storage period; on the other hand, pre-cooking can effectively kill microorganisms and insect eggs on the surface of corn cobs, ensuring the hygiene and food safety of processed foods; it can also squeeze out the air in the tender corn tissue, increase the anti-expansion pressure, and reduce the damage rate during sterilization; correspondingly reduce the oxidation of raw materials, which is beneficial to preserve the color and nutrition of the product to a certain extent, making the sweet corn cobs have a cooked feel.
The formation of corn sweetness mainly depends on the gelatinization degree of amylopectin in the endosperm during the pre-cooking stage. Only after full gelatinization can the sweet corn flavor be obtained, and the same flavor quality can be maintained after sterilization. However, if the gelatinization is not good, the amylopectin cannot be further gelatinized during the sterilization process. Make the product unsuitable for consumption. If the pre-cooking time is too long, the corn kernels will break and the flavor will decrease. Therefore, we use its flavor, palatability and grain cracking as comprehensive evaluation indicators to determine the blanching time.
High temperature sterilization. For most vacuum packaging, thorough and timely sterilization is the key to extending the shelf life.
